What are online coding jobs?

Online coding jobs fall into two categories. The first focuses on medical billing, where you provide support for companies that submit documentation to insurance companies. The second category focuses on software, where you develop new programs, translate content into different languages, or analyze data for your employer. Online coding jobs usually focus on smaller projects that can last anywhere from days to weeks based on the needs of the client. A few online coding jobs are long-term projects, but these are relatively rare and not a good measure for the overall industry.

Position Purpose

Provides high level technical competency and subject matter expertise analyzing physician/provider documentation contained in assigned Complex Outpatient (CO) and/or Inpatient health records to determine the principal diagnosis, secondary diagnoses, principal procedure and secondary procedures. Provides appropriate Medical Severity Diagnostic Related Groups (MS-DRG), Present on Admission (POA), Severity of Illness (SOI) & Risk of Mortality (ROM) assignments for Inpatient records and accurate APC assignments and all required modifiers for Complex Outpatient records. Utilizes encoder software applications, which includes all applicable online tools and references in the assignment of International Classification of Diseases, Clinical Modification (ICD-CM) diagnosis and procedure codes, Current Procedural Terminology (CPT) / Healthcare Common Procedure Coding System (HCPCS) procedure codes, MS-DRG, POA, SOI & ROM assignments and assignment of APC's and all required modifiers.

Assigns appropriate code(s) by utilizing coding guidelines established by:

  • The Centers for Medicare/Medicaid Services (CMS) ICD-CM Official Coding Guidelines for Coding and Reporting, ICD-PCS Official Guidelines for Coding and Reporting
  • American Hospital Association (AHA) Coding Clinic for International Classification of Diseases, Clinical Modification
  • American Medical Association (AMA) CPT Assistant for CPT codes
  • American Health Information Management Association (AHIMA) Standards of Ethical Coding
  • Revenue Excellence/RHM Organization coding policies
Essential Functions
  • Knows, understands, incorporates, and demonstrates the Insight Hospital Mission, Vision, and Values in behaviors, practices, and decisions.
  • Adheres to Insight Health confidentiality requirements as they relate to the release of any individual or aggregate patient information.
  • Proficiently navigates the patient health record and other computer systems/sources to accurately determine diagnosis and procedures codes, MS-DRGs and APCs.
  • Codes Complex Outpatient or Inpatient utilizing encoder software and online tools and references, in the assignment of ICD, CPT, HCPCS codes, MS-DRG, POA, SOI & ROM assignments, APC assignment and all required modifiers.
  • Consults reference materials to facilitate code assignment.
  • Understands appropriate link of diagnosis to procedure.
  • Appends modifier(s) to procedure code or service when applicable.
  • Collaborates with HIM and Patient Financial Services in resolving billing and utilization issues affecting reimbursement.
  • Interprets bundling and unbundling guidelines (NCCI).
  • Interprets LCDs/NCDs and payer policies.
  • Tracks issues (i.e., missing documentation, charges or Inpatient queries that require follow-up to facilitate coding in a timely fashion).
  • Investigates claims denials and/or appeals as directed.
  • Consistently meets or exceeds coding quality and productivity standards.
  • Maintains up-to-date knowledge of changes in coding and reimbursement guidelines and regulations.
  • Identifies concerns and responsible for providing resolution of moderate to complex problems. Notifies appropriate leadership for resolution when appropriate.
  • Performs other duties as assigned by Leadership.
  • Maintains a working knowledge of applicable coding and reimbursement Federal, State and local laws and regulations, the Compliance Accountability Program, Code of Ethics, as well as other policies and procedures in order to ensure adherence in a manner that reflects honest, ethical and professional behavior
Minimum Qualifications
  • Completion of an AHIMA-approved coding program or an AAPC-approved coding program, or Associate's degree in Health Information Management or a related field or an equivalent combination of years of education and experience is required. Bachelor's degree in Health Information Management (HIM) or related healthcare field is preferred.
  • Certified Coding Specialist (CCS), Certified Procedural Coder (CPC), Registered Health Information Technician (RHIT), Registered Health Information Administrator (RHIA).
  • Two (2) years of current Complex Outpatient or Inpatient coding experience is required. Three (3) to five (5) years of current Complex Outpatient or Inpatient coding experienced preferred. Current experience doing remote coding is a plus.
  • Extensive comprehensive working knowledge of medical terminology, Anatomy and Physiology, diagnostic and procedural coding and MS-DRG or APC grouping. Current experience doing remote coding is a plus.
  • Current experience utilizing encoding/grouping software or CAC is preferred. Ability to utilize both manual and automated versions of the ICD, CPT, and HCPCS coding classification systems is preferred.
